哪个 heroku dynos 更适合 1500 多个活跃用户的应用程序?
Which heroku dynos is better for 1500+ active users on application?
我已经在 Heroku Hobby dynos 上部署了我的 nodeJS 后端。有 1500 多个活跃用户。所以 API 响应时间有时很慢,请帮忙找出哪个 dynos 更适合后端部署。
这始终取决于您的应用程序。您在 API 中处理什么类型的操作和工作负载,您有任何 synchronous/blocking 操作吗?是否涉及很多I/O?有关您要实现的目标的更多信息将有助于提供更好的建议。
Node.js 的一个最佳实践是水平扩展,这意味着使用多个小型服务器来处理流量,而不是使用一个大型服务器(垂直扩展)。因此,一个好的建议是使用倍数测功机进行缩放,尝试缩放到 2 并再次测量以查看它是否符合您的性能需求。
部分推荐读物:
我已经在 Heroku Hobby dynos 上部署了我的 nodeJS 后端。有 1500 多个活跃用户。所以 API 响应时间有时很慢,请帮忙找出哪个 dynos 更适合后端部署。
这始终取决于您的应用程序。您在 API 中处理什么类型的操作和工作负载,您有任何 synchronous/blocking 操作吗?是否涉及很多I/O?有关您要实现的目标的更多信息将有助于提供更好的建议。
Node.js 的一个最佳实践是水平扩展,这意味着使用多个小型服务器来处理流量,而不是使用一个大型服务器(垂直扩展)。因此,一个好的建议是使用倍数测功机进行缩放,尝试缩放到 2 并再次测量以查看它是否符合您的性能需求。
部分推荐读物: